/* CSS Document */
body {margin:0px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px;}
div,img,td,table {margin:0px; padding:0px;}
#main {width:782px; margin:0 auto;}

#main-logo {width:780px;  background:#f5f5fe; float:left;}

.clear {clear:both;}

#logo {width:780px; clear:both;}
#logo p {margin:0px; padding:15px 45px 22px 33px; display:block;}

#links {width:780px;  font-weight:bold; color:#FFFFFF; margin:0px; clear:both;}
#links ul {margin:0px; padding:0px 1px 1px 77px;}
#links ul li {background:url(image/home.jpg) no-repeat; width:116px; height:25px; float:left; list-style-type:none; text-align:center; margin:0px 0px 0px 1px; line-height:22px; display:block;}
#links ul li a {color:#FFFFFF; text-decoration:none;}

#image {width:780px; clear:both;}
#image ul {margin:0px; padding:0px;}
#image ul li {float:left; list-style-type:none;}
#image ul li img {float:left;}

#middle {width:780px; background:url(image/middle.jpg) top repeat-x;}

.homebg {background:url(image/back.jpg) bottom repeat-x #d0e7fd;}

#left {width:185px; float:left; background:url(image/left-back.jpg) repeat-y; margin:3px 0px 0px 0px;}
#left p {margin:0px; padding:5px 0px 3px 8px;}
#left p img {margin:0px; padding:0px;}

#right {width:595px; float:right; background:url(image/back.jpg) bottom repeat-x #d0e7fd; margin:3px 0px 0px 0px;}
#right p {margin:0px; padding:12px 0px 0px 5px;}
#right h1 {margin:0px; padding:0px 5px 14px 3px; text-align:justify; font-weight:normal; font-size:12px; line-height:17px;}
#right h2 {margin:0px; padding:0px 5px 14px 3px; font-weight:normal; font-size:12px; line-height:17px;}
#right h2 a { color:#1800ff; text-decoration:none;}
#right ul {margin:0px; padding:5px 0px 12px 5px;}
#right ul li {background:url(image/li.gif) no-repeat top left; list-style-type:none; padding:0px 0px 0px 25px; line-height:18px;}

#right1 {width:595px; float:right; background:url(image/back.jpg) bottom repeat-x #d0e7fd; margin:3px 0px 0px 0px;}
#right1 p {margin:0px; padding:12px 10px 0px 15px;}
#right1 h1 {margin:0px; padding:0px 15px 14px 15px; text-align:justify; font-weight:normal; font-size:12px; line-height:17px;}
#right1 h2 {margin:0px; padding:0px 15px 14px 15px; font-weight:normal; font-size:12px; line-height:17px;}
#right1 h3 {margin:0px; padding:0px 15px 0px 15px; font-weight:normal; font-size:12px; line-height:17px;}
#right1 h2 a { color:#1800ff; text-decoration:none;}
#right1 ul {margin:0px; padding:10px 0px 12px 15px;}
#right1 ul li {background:url(image/li.gif) no-repeat left top; list-style-type:none; padding:0px 20px 0px 25px; line-height:18px;}


#patner {width:595px;}
#patner p {margin:0px; padding:8px 0px 0px 10px;}

#patner1 {width:240px; float:left;}
#patner1 p {margin:0px; padding:40px 0px 0px 10px;}

#patner2 {width:350px; float:right;}
#patner2 h1 {margin:0px; padding:70px 15px 10px 0px; text-align:justify; font-weight:normal; font-size:12px; line-height:17px;}

#bottom {width:780px; clear:both; background:#f0f9ff;}
#bottom p {margin:0px; padding:10px; text-align:center;}
#bottom p a {color:#000000; text-decoration:none;}

#bg {margin:0px; padding:0px; background:#3c7fc3; width:780px; height:10px;}

#allcopy {width:780px; clear:both; font-size:11px;}
#allcopy p {margin:0px; padding:5px 25px 10px 0px; text-align:right;}
#allcopy p a {color:#000000; text-decoration:none;}
#allcopy p a:hover {color:#e28a30; text-decoration:underline;}

#text {width:595px; margin:0px;}
#text p {margin:0px; padding:12px 15px 72px 15px; text-align:justify; line-height:17px;}
#text ul {margin:0px; padding:5px 10px 2px 15px;}
#text ul li {background:url(image/li.gif) no-repeat top left; list-style-type:none; padding:0px 0px 0px 25px; line-height:18px;}
#text ol {margin:0px; padding:0px 0px 0px 60px;}
#text ol li {margin:0px; padding:0px; line-height:17px;}

#form-div {width:595px; clear:both;}
#form-div p {margin:0px; padding:5px 0px 5px 5px;}

.left-text {width:595px; font-size:12px;}
.left-text p {margin:0px; padding:0px;}
.left-text p span {color:#0000FF; margin:0px; padding:0px;}


.form3 {width:165px; height:15px; border:1px solid #000066; height:inherit;}

.select-form {width:169px; border:1px solid #000066; height:18px;}
.formww {width:165px; border:1px solid #000066; height:70px;}

.submit {height:23px; width:65px; margin:0px;}

#contact-us {width:230px; float:left; margin:25px 0px 0px 0px;}
#contact-us p {margin:0px; padding:0px; text-align:right;}



#contact {width:345px;  float:right; margin:55px 0px 0px 0px;}
#contact p {margin:0px; padding:5px 0px 5px 20px; font-size:14px; font-weight:bold;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;}
#contact h1 {margin:0px; padding:5px 10px 0px 20px; font-size:13px; font-weight:normal;}
#contact h1 a {color:#0000CC; text-decoration:none;}
#contact h2 {margin:0px; padding:15px 10px 0px 20px; font-size:14px; font-weight:bold;}
#contact h3 {margin:0px; padding:8px 20px 3px 10px; font-size:13px; color:#3e76c2; text-align:right;}


.deepak {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:12px; padding:10px 0px 0px 10px; margin:0px;}
.deepak ul { margin:0px; padding:0px;}
.deepak ul li { margin:0px; padding:10px 0px 0px 0px; list-style-type:none; background:none;}

.td_padding2 {padding:3px 5px 3px 0px;}
.td_padding2 img {border:1px solid #004b5e;}

.photo {font-size:18px; font-family:Arial, Helvetica, sans-serif; color:#03478b; font-weight:bold;}
.photo p {margin:0px; padding:5px 10px;}
